IDLE中的熊猫(Pandas)库导入时间较长的原因是因为Pandas库在导入时需要加载大量的数据和依赖项。以下是关于这个问题的完善且全面的答案:
熊猫(Pandas)是一个开源的数据分析和数据处理库,它提供了高性能、易用的数据结构和数据分析工具,广泛应用于数据科学、机器学习和数据处理等领域。
熊猫库的导入时间较长主要有以下几个原因:
- 数据加载:熊猫库在导入时会加载大量的数据,包括各种数据结构和算法的实现。这些数据需要被加载到内存中,因此会占用一定的时间和资源。
- 依赖项加载:熊猫库依赖于其他的Python库,如NumPy、Matplotlib等。在导入熊猫库时,这些依赖项也需要被加载到内存中,因此会增加导入时间。
- 编译和解释:熊猫库是用C语言编写的,因此在导入时需要进行编译和解释。这个过程需要一定的时间和计算资源。
尽管熊猫库的导入时间较长,但它具有以下优势和应用场景:
优势:
- 强大的数据处理能力:熊猫库提供了丰富的数据结构和数据处理函数,可以高效地进行数据清洗、转换、分析和可视化。
- 高性能的计算能力:熊猫库基于NumPy库,使用了向量化计算和优化算法,能够快速处理大规模数据。
- 灵活的数据操作:熊猫库支持灵活的数据操作,如数据切片、索引、合并、聚合等,方便用户进行复杂的数据操作。
应用场景:
- 数据分析和数据处理:熊猫库广泛应用于数据科学、机器学习和数据处理等领域,可以帮助用户进行数据清洗、特征工程、数据建模等任务。
- 金融分析和量化交易:熊猫库提供了丰富的金融分析函数和工具,可以帮助用户进行股票、期货等金融数据的分析和交易策略的开发。
- 数据可视化:熊猫库结合Matplotlib等库,可以方便地进行数据可视化,帮助用户更直观地理解和展示数据。
腾讯云相关产品和产品介绍链接地址:
- 腾讯云服务器(CVM):提供高性能、可扩展的云服务器实例,满足各类应用场景的需求。产品介绍链接
- 腾讯云对象存储(COS):提供安全可靠的云端存储服务,适用于海量数据的存储和访问。产品介绍链接
- 腾讯云人工智能(AI):提供丰富的人工智能服务和解决方案,包括图像识别、语音识别、自然语言处理等。产品介绍链接
请注意,以上只是腾讯云的一些相关产品,其他云计算品牌商也提供类似的产品和服务。